What speaker distance means in a Klipsch setup

Speaker distance is the amount of delay your AV receiver or processor applies so sound from each speaker reaches your listening position at the right time.

In a home theater, this helps align the front left, center, right, surrounds, and subwoofer for accurate soundstage placement.

In stereo listening, proper distance settings improve imaging and make vocals and instruments appear anchored in space.

Klipsch speakers are often highly efficient and revealing, which means timing errors can be easier to hear.

Even small mismatches in distance can affect dialogue clarity, panning effects, and bass integration.

Why speaker distance matters for Klipsch speakers

Klipsch designs many speakers with horn-loaded tweeters and high sensitivity, which can produce strong transients and precise detail.

That precision is useful, but it also makes setup choices more audible.

If distance values are wrong, you may notice:

  • Dialogue pulling toward one side of the room
  • Weak center-channel anchoring
  • Surround effects arriving too early or too late
  • Reduced stereo imaging and narrower soundstage
  • Subwoofer bass that feels detached from the main speakers

Correct distance settings help your AV receiver calculate delay so all channels arrive in sync at the main listening position, often called the MLP.

How to set Klipsch speaker distance in an AV receiver

The exact menu labels vary by brand, but the process is similar on Denon, Marantz, Yamaha, Onkyo, Pioneer, and Sony receivers.

You can usually enter distances manually after running auto calibration or after measuring the room yourself.

Step 1: Measure from the main listening position

Measure the straight-line distance from each speaker to the primary seat or listening point.

Use a tape measure or laser measure and aim for the acoustic center of each speaker, not the front edge of the cabinet.

For Klipsch floorstanding speakers, measure to the midpoint of the speaker’s driver array.

For a Klipsch center channel, measure to the center of the speaker or to the main tweeter area if that is the most prominent acoustic source.

For surround speakers, measure from the seating position to the speaker grill or acoustic center.

Step 2: Enter the distances in the receiver

Open the speaker setup menu and enter the measured values for each channel.

Most receivers use feet or meters, and the units should match the physical measurements you made.

If your receiver offers both automatic and manual distance entry, manual entry is often the best way to verify the final result.

Typical channels to check include:

  • Front left and right Klipsch speakers
  • Center channel
  • Surround and rear surround speakers
  • Height or Atmos speakers
  • Subwoofer, if the receiver allows distance adjustment

Step 3: Fine-tune for timing, not just numbers

Measured distance is the starting point, but the best result sometimes comes from small adjustments.

If voices seem to drift or effects sound smeared, try changing one speaker by small increments and listening again.

Many receivers allow adjustments in small steps, which makes this process manageable.

Small changes can matter more than exact tape-measure precision because room reflections, speaker toe-in, and listener position also affect arrival time.

The goal is not perfect math alone; it is the most convincing sound at the seat you use most often.

How to set Klipsch speaker distance for a subwoofer

Subwoofer distance is often misunderstood because low bass behaves differently from midrange and treble.

Still, the distance setting matters because it controls delay and phase alignment between the subwoofer and the main speakers.

If your Klipsch system uses a separate subwoofer, set its distance in the receiver if the option is available.

Start with the physical distance from the subwoofer to the main listening position, then listen to the crossover region where the sub and mains overlap.

Signs the subwoofer distance may need adjustment include:

  • Bass sounding late or detached from the kick drum
  • A hole in the crossover region around 80 Hz to 120 Hz
  • Bass that changes noticeably when you move your head slightly
  • Poor integration between Klipsch mains and the subwoofer

If the receiver does not provide a meaningful subwoofer distance control, you may need to use the subwoofer’s phase switch or a more advanced calibration tool to improve alignment.

Should you trust auto calibration systems?

Many receivers include auto setup platforms such as Audyssey, Dirac Live, YPAO, MCACC, or AccuEQ.

These systems can estimate speaker distance, EQ, and level, and they are often a strong starting point.

However, auto calibration is not always exact, especially with reflective rooms, asymmetrical seating, or unusual speaker placement.

For Klipsch speakers, auto calibration may slightly understate or overstate a channel’s effective timing because the system is measuring acoustic arrival, not just tape-measure distance.

That is why checking the results manually is important.

If the auto-calibrated values seem far from reality, remeasure and compare.

Distance vs level vs crossover: what to adjust first

Speaker distance is only one part of the setup process.

If the system still sounds off after you enter the correct distances, review these settings in order:

  1. Speaker distance for timing alignment
  2. Speaker level for balance between channels
  3. Crossover frequency for smooth handoff to the subwoofer
  4. Toe-in and placement for imaging and directivity
  5. Room correction or EQ for tonal balance

Many Klipsch owners hear the biggest improvement by correcting distance and crossover together, especially when using a center channel and subwoofer.

A good crossover setting often helps the distance settings work more effectively.

Common placement mistakes that affect distance settings

Even when the receiver settings are correct, poor placement can make the system sound wrong.

Watch for these common issues:

  • One front speaker closer to the wall than the other
  • Center channel placed too low or pushed deep into a cabinet
  • Surrounds mounted too close to the ears
  • Unequal toe-in between left and right Klipsch speakers
  • Listening position too close to a back wall

Klipsch speakers often deliver strong direct sound, so asymmetrical placement can become obvious quickly.

Before changing distances repeatedly, make sure the speakers are positioned as evenly as possible around the main seat.

How to tell when the distance is right

You will know the settings are close when dialogue locks to the center channel, front-stage sounds move smoothly across the screen, and stereo tracks place instruments clearly between the speakers.

Bass should also feel connected rather than separate from the main system.

A well-set Klipsch system should sound immediate but not harsh, detailed but not fragmented.

Proper speaker distance helps the receiver preserve that balance by keeping timing consistent across the entire setup.
